SQL实用教程:数据操作与表结构详解

需积分: 10 0 下载量 68 浏览量 更新于2024-07-22 收藏 4.38MB PDF 举报
"SQL+实用系列经典教程"是一本针对IT专业人士的必备参考书籍,它深入浅出地介绍了SQL的基础知识和实用技巧。该教程主要围绕SQL(Structured Query Language,结构化查询语言)展开,这是一种用于管理和操作关系型数据库的标准语言。 第一讲聚焦于SQL的基本语法,讲解了数据库和表的概念。数据库通常由一个或多个表构成,如"Persons"表,包含了Id、LastName、FirstName、Address和City等字段,每个记录表示一条数据行。SQL语句分为数据操作语言(DML)和数据定义语言(DDL)两大部分。DML包括SELECT(用于获取数据)、UPDATE(修改数据)、DELETE(删除数据)和INSERT INTO(插入数据),它们用于实际的数据操作。而DDL则负责创建、修改和删除数据库对象,如CREATEDATABASE(创建数据库)、ALTERDATABASE(修改数据库)、CREATETABLE(创建表)、ALTERTABLE(改变表结构)、DROPTABLE(删除表)、CREATEINDEX(创建索引)和DROPINDEX(删除索引)等,这些都是构建和维护数据库结构的关键语句。 第二讲进一步深入到SELECT语句,这是SQL中最常用的操作之一。SELECT语句用于从表中选择特定的列或者所有列,并将结果组织成一个结果集。其基本语法是`SELECT 列名(s) FROM 表名`,如`SELECT LastName, FirstName FROM Persons`,能够提取所需数据,提高工作效率。通过实例演示,读者可以更好地理解和掌握如何编写和运用SQL查询来满足实际工作中的需求。 这本教程对于提升程序员在处理数据库时的技能非常有帮助,无论是初学者还是经验丰富的开发者,都可以从中找到实用的方法和技巧,解决他们在开发过程中遇到的问题。通过学习并熟练运用SQL,用户可以更有效地管理和操作数据,从而推动项目的顺利进行。